What's behind Turkey-Greece saber-rattling

On the surface, it appears as a squabble over who’s entitled to potentially abundant hydrocarbons lurking beneath the seabed in the eastern Mediterranean. However, "it’s not about energy,” says Ian O. Lesser, a political analyst with the US think tank the German Marshall Fund.
